WHY CHOOSE TADOUSSAC AS THE SITE FOR A BIRD OBSERVATORY ?
 

The installation of a bird observatory at Tadoussac is justified by:

  • the important concentration of birds that are observed at the site each autumn;

  • a large diversity of species associated with the diversity of the surrounding environments;

  • the fact that it is an open and accessible site that lends itself to the observation and banding of migrating birds;

  • the passage of an important proportion of Boreal forest nesting bird species;

  • the framework of the Parc national du Saguenay and the public demand for ecotouristic activities.

WHEN IS THE BEST TIME TO COME AND WATCH THE AUTUMN MIGRATION AT TADOUSSAC ?
 

The forecast of a passing cold front and/or of a north-westerly wind are, generally speaking, good indicators that conditions will be favourable for migration.
